– Sveriges BNP för 4:e kvartalet 2010 visade en mycket stark siffra. Riksbanken höjde räntan som väntat vid sitt möte och och varnade för att den kan behöva höjas något mer än tidigare. Priset på pengar i banksystemet fortsätter att indikera en kris. ECB utlovar en räntehöjning i april, debatten inom BOE är het och USA har som vanligt svårt att genomföra något som kan minska sina finansiella obalanser, skriver Carlsson Norén Macro Fund i februari kommentar.

– Efter en inledande nedgång, är räntorna dock på väg upp i världen, eftersom priset på olja leder till högre inflation. Därför kan vi se fram emot högre räntor från centralbankerna i både Asien och Europa, skriver Carlsson Norén Macro Fund.
Carlsson Norén Macro Fund sjönk 0,62 procent i februari 2011.
